Okro ideal for diabetic patients – Nutritionist

Yemisi Olowookere, a Nutritionist with Garki Hospital, Abuja, has advised Nigerians to cultivate the habit of consuming okra as the eugenol in okra helps fight diabetes.

Olowookere told the News Agency of Nigeria on Tuesday in Abuja that the fibre also helps stabilise blood sugar level by delaying sugar absorption from the intestines.

According to her, okro is one of the best vegetable sources of dietary fibre essential for the digestive system.

She said: “Dietary fibres in okro help prevent and relieve constipation.

“The soluble fibre in okro absorbs water and adds bulk to the stool thus preventing constipation.

“Being a vegetable, it is obvious that okro is healthy and should be included in one’s menu.”

Olowookere said okro was good to improve colon health by allowing the organ to work at a higher rate of efficiency and reduce the risk of colon cancer.

She said the iron content of okra forms haemoglobin in the blood and prevents anaemia, adding that vitamin K helps in blood coagulation.

Olowookere said the dietary fibres contained in this vegetable help people who are on weight loss programmes, adding that okro has a very low caloric value so it is a great addition when losing weight.

She said: “The soluble fibre in okro helps to lower serum cholesterol and thus reduces the risk of heart disease.

“Eating okro is an effective way to control the body’s cholesterol level.

“Okro is also high in pectin that helps in lowering high blood cholesterol by altering the production of bile in the intestines.”

Olowookere said okro can help improve healthy hair and reduces dandruff.

She said the high Vitamin C content in okro helps fight cold and cough by encouraging a healthy immune system.

She said: “The Vitamin C and many essential minerals like magnesium, manganese, calcium and iron in okro also fight against harmful free radicals and therefore promote an overall healthy immune system.

“Vitamin A and beta carotene found in okro are
essential nutrients for maintaining good eyesight.

“The essential nutrients also help prevent eye related diseases such as cataracts.

“The Vitamin A promotes good eye health and protects against age related eye disorders.”

Olowookere said the high amount of folate contained in okro is beneficial for the foetus during pregnancy, adding that folate is an essential nutrient, which improves the development of the foetus’ brain.

Olowookere said the high amount of folic acid in okro plays an important role in the neural tube formation of the foetus from the fourth to the twelfth week of pregnancy.
